Soap Actor Hendrickson Dies at 55

“As the World Turns” star Benjamin Hendrickson died over the weekend at his home in Huntington, N.Y. The Emmy winner was 55. There was no word about cause of death Wednesday.

His last airdate as Hal Munson will be July 12.

“‘As The World Turns,’ Procter & Gamble Productions and the entire daytime community have lost a dear friend and a talented actor who brought to life the character of Hal Munson,” “ATWT” executive producer Christopher Goutman said in an announcement Wednesday. “Benjamin always joked that he was hired for one day, then before he knew it he’d impregnated the leading lady and had to sign a contract. He intended to stay with the show for one year. How lucky for us and the fans that we had him for 21 years.”

Mr. Hendrickson’s staying power on the CBS soap “is testimony to a gifted actor whose talent and loyalty will always be remembered by his fans and co-workers, as well as a very appreciative network,” said Barbara Bloom, senior VP for daytime programs at CBS.
